27 Reviews
One of the better free campsites for sure! You do have to drive for 8km on a gravel road to get there and it seemed very popular so would recommend getting there early in the day to get a spot. Limited spaces for campervans, definitely more space for tents but lots of cars had to turn back when the car parking spaces were full from about 6pm. Toilets were actually very clean as drop toilets go. And there are fire pits and picnic tables around. Great wildlife, saw some kangas and a koala bear.
Lots of wildlife to observe including koalas if you're lucky. BYO firewood.
